Two sailing yachts are recorded, the Fifer 33 and the Motorketch, both with construction years from 1965 to 1972. Production therefore goes back a long way, details of size or construction are not on record. For the insurance contract, the type of boat, value, year of construction, sail area and cruising range are sufficient.
On sailing yachts the sail area is used for the premium, not the engine power. Added to this are the type of boat, value, year of construction and cruising range. A yacht from the sixties is thus rated according to the same features as a current boat.
For the value the agreed value applies, compensation is paid with no deduction for depreciation ("new for old"), in the Premium tariff with no age limit. We insure regardless of year of construction, place of purchase and previous owners. Club races are included from Basis-Plus, races with scoring status you state when taking out the policy.

Series by Miller & Sons, build years and cover
Fifer 33 is a sailing yacht from Miller & Sons, built from 1965 to 1972.
Motorketch is a sailing yacht from Miller & Sons, built from 1965 to 1972.
For a series of this age there is no list price left. That is why we work with an agreed value: you state the figure, we agree it, and in a total loss exactly that amount is paid, with no deduction for wear.
On sailing yachts the rig and the underwater hull are the expensive parts: a dismasting quickly costs a quarter of the boat, and osmosis counts as wear and is covered by no hull policy.
